In a new interview to promote the upcoming TRON Lightcycle / Run attraction, which opens next month in the Magic Kingdom at Walt Disney World, Disney Imagineer Chris Beatty touched on a few other projects in the works, including a new villain-themed land — which for fans. have been asking for years.

“Every day we dream about what’s next at Walt Disney World. We just wanted to give you a sneak peek at some of the amazing things to come. It changes every day. It’s exciting,” he said EW. “I think Josh (D’Amaro) really tried to get across that spirit of creativity of what could be next, of innovation, of the possibility of what could be, is still alive and well at Disney and Imagineering,” he continued. say, referring to the D23 presentation that took place in September.

The presentation wasn’t meant to share specific plans, but rather to give his team a chance to show fans they’re “dreaming” of what could come to the park.

“(The villains concept) got a pretty good round of applause,” he recalled when his team put the concept art on screen at the D23 presentation. “We took note of how loud the applause was when we announced this,” the Imagineer continued, hinting that the villain-themed land might actually come to life.

While Disney Imagineers haven’t confirmed what will be included in the new Villans area expansion, they have mentioned the possibility of living in the Magic Kingdom behind the Big Thunder Mountain attraction, calling the whole concept the “Beyond Big Thunder Mountain” project.

Disney World is preparing to open its newest roller coaster at the Magic Kingdom, the TRON Lightcycle / Run, which is currently in the preview stage so Disney World Annual Passholders can try the ride before the official opening on April 4th.

At EPCOT, Imagineers are putting the finishing touches on the Moana-inspired Journey of Water, set to open in late 2023. The company called the Moana-inspired Journey of Water a “luscious journey of discovery” that allows guests to “play with magical, living water.”

Additionally, Disney World announced new character meet and greets at the parks, including Moana, Mirabel from “Encanto” and Figment from EPCOT’s iconic attraction Journey Into Imagination with Figment, all set to debut sometime this year.
